Since its first identification in Scotland, over 1,000 cases of unexplained paediatric hepatitis in children have been reported worldwide, including 278 cases in the UK1. Here we report an investigation of 38 cases, 66 age-matched immunocompetent controls and 21 immunocompromised comparator participants, using a combination of genomic, transcriptomic, proteomic and immunohistochemical methods. We detected high levels of adeno-associated virus 2 (AAV2) DNA in the liver, blood, plasma or stool from 27 of 28 cases. We found low levels of adenovirus (HAdV) and human herpesvirus 6B (HHV-6B) in 23 of 31 and 16 of 23, respectively, of the cases tested. By contrast, AAV2 was infrequently detected and at low titre in the blood or the liver from control children with HAdV, even when profoundly immunosuppressed. AAV2, HAdV and HHV-6 phylogeny excluded the emergence of novel strains in cases. Histological analyses of explanted livers showed enrichment for T cells and B lineage cells. Proteomic comparison of liver tissue from cases and healthy controls identified increased expression of HLA class 2, immunoglobulin variable regions and complement proteins. HAdV and AAV2 proteins were not detected in the livers. Instead, we identified AAV2 DNA complexes reflecting both HAdV-mediated and HHV-6B-mediated replication. We hypothesize that high levels of abnormal AAV2 replication products aided by HAdV and, in severe cases, HHV-6B may have triggered immune-mediated hepatic disease in genetically and immunologically predisposed children.

Like other elite athletes, ballet dancers are highly dedicated to the pursuit of their vocation. They work to perfect their bodies, their movements and their expression of the art form. The lockdowns that occurred during the COVID-19 pandemic represented a significant interruption to the extraordinary but everyday lives of ballet dancers, creating unique environments where exploration of the embodied habitus of ballet can be further investigated. The impacts of lockdown upon dancers were explored via a series of interviews with 12 professional dancers from Germany. Framed by previous research, theorising the balletic body from a Bourdieusian perspective, interview data were analysed using Interpretative Phenomenological Analysis. Our research highlights the way in which COVID-19 lockdowns and associated restrictions disrupt the habitus of dancers and results in a form of suffering that is comparable to injury or chronic illness. Our research suggests that individuals respond to the 'structural injuries' of lockdown measures in a manner comparable to the way they respond to physiological injury. Thus, dancers sought to repair or re-establish the social structures they ordinarily inhabit whilst the inevitable limitations of such efforts engendered occasions for reflexive thinking about their role, careers and identity as dancers.

STUDY OBJECTIVE: Investigate outcomes for patients undergoing minimally invasive hysterectomies (MIHs) performed for endometrial cancer at ambulatory surgery centers (ASCs). DESIGN: Our study aimed to explore the feasibility and discharge outcomes for MIHs for endometrial cancer in an ASC setting by using same-day discharge data. SETTING: The prevalence of MIH for endometrial cancer between 2016 and 2019 was estimated from the Nationwide Ambulatory Surgery Sample. PATIENTS: Patients who underwent MIHs for endometrial cancer at an ASC were included. INTERVENTIONS: N/A MEASUREMENTS MAIN RESULTS: Weighted estimates of prevalence and association between discharge status and sociodemographic factors were explored. Same-day discharge was defined as discharge on the day of surgery, and delayed discharge was defined as discharge after the day of surgery. An estimated 95 041 MIHs for endometrial cancer were performed at ASCs between 2016 and 2019. Notably, 91.9% (n = 87 372) resulted in same-day discharge, 1.2% (n = 1121) had delayed discharge, and 6.9% (n = 6548) had missing discharge information; 78.7% procedures (n = 68 812) were performed at public hospitals. The proportion of delayed discharges were lower in private, not-for profit ASCs (0.8%, p = .03) than public hospitals. Patients who had delayed discharges on average were older (69.7 vs 62.4 years, p <.001), more likely to have comorbid conditions including diabetes (adjusted odds ratio [aOR] 1.48, 95% confidence interval [CI] 1.25-1.75) and overweight or obese body mass indices (aOR 1.18, 95% CI 1.01-1.39), and more likely to have public insurance (aOR 1.78, 95% CI 1.40-2.25). CONCLUSION: MIHs for endometrial cancer are feasible in an ASC. Optimal candidates for receipt of MIHs for endometrial cancer at an ASC are patients who are younger and have less comorbidities, lower body mass index, and private insurance.

BackgroundIn 2020, Wales experienced some of the highest rates of confirmed COVID-19 cases in Europe. We set up a serosurveillance scheme using residual samples from blood donations to inform the pandemic response in Wales.AimTo identify changes in SARS-CoV-2 antibody seroprevalence in Wales by time, demography and location.MethodsResidual samples from blood donations made in Wales between 29 June 2020 and 20 November 2022 were tested for antibodies to the nucleocapsid antigen (anti-N) of SARS-CoV-2, resulting from natural infection. Donations made between 12 April 2021 and 20 November 2022 were also tested for antibodies to the spike antigen (anti-S) occurring as a result of natural infection and vaccination.ResultsAge-standardised seroprevalence of anti-N antibodies in donors remained stable (4.4-5.5%) until November 2020 before increasing to 16.7% by February 2021. Trends remained steady until November 2021 before increasing, peaking in November 2022 (80.2%). For anti-S, seroprevalence increased from 67.1% to 98.6% between May and September 2021, then remained above 99%. Anti-N seroprevalence was highest in younger donors and in donors living in urban South Wales. In contrast, seroprevalence of anti-S was highest in older donors and was similar across regions. No significant difference was observed by sex. Seroprevalence of anti-N antibodies was higher in Black, Asian and other minority ethnicities (self-reported) compared with White donors, with the converse observed for anti-S antibodies.ConclusionWe successfully set up long-term serological surveillance of SARS-CoV-2 using residual samples from blood donations, demonstrating variation based on age, ethnicity and location.

Enteroviruses are a common cause of seasonal childhood infections. The vast majority of enterovirus infections are mild and self-limiting, although neonates can sometimes develop severe disease. Myocarditis is a rare complication of enterovirus infection. Between June 2022 and April 2023, twenty cases of severe neonatal enteroviral myocarditis caused by coxsackie B viruses were reported in the United Kingdom. Sixteen required critical care support and two died. Enterovirus PCR on whole blood was the most sensitive diagnostic test. We describe the initial public health investigation into this cluster and aim to raise awareness among paediatricians, laboratories and public health specialists.

Treatment failures with artemisinin combination therapies (ACTs) threaten global efforts to eradicate malaria. They highlight the importance of identifying drug targets and new inhibitors and of studying how existing antimalarial classes work. Here, we report the successful development of a heterologous expression-based compound-screening tool. The validated drug target Plasmodium falciparum ATPase 6 (PfATP6) and a mammalian orthologue (sarco/endoplasmic reticulum calcium ATPase 1a [SERCA1a]) were functionally expressed in Saccharomyces cerevisiae, providing a robust, sensitive, and specific screening tool. Whole-cell and in vitro assays consistently demonstrated inhibition and labeling of PfATP6 by artemisinins. Mutations in PfATP6 resulted in fitness costs that were ameliorated in the presence of artemisinin derivatives when studied in the yeast model. As previously hypothesized, PfATP6 is a target of artemisinins. Mammalian SERCA1a can be mutated to become more susceptible to artemisinins. The inexpensive, low-technology yeast screening platform has identified unrelated classes of druggable PfATP6 inhibitors. Resistance to artemisinins may depend on mechanisms that can concomitantly address multitargeting by artemisinins and fitness costs of mutations that reduce artemisinin susceptibility.

Cannabis is one of the most frequently used psychoactive substances in the world. The most common route of administration for cannabis and cannabinoid constituents such as Δ-9-tetrahydrocannabinol (THC) and cannabidiol (CBD) is via smoking or vapor inhalation. Preclinical vapor models have been developed, although the vaporization devices and delivery methods vary widely across laboratories. This review examines the emerging field of preclinical vapor models with a focus on cannabinoid exposure in order to (1) summarize vapor exposure parameters and other methodological details across studies; (2) discuss the pharmacological and behavioral effects produced by exposure to vaporized cannabinoids; and (3) compare behavioral effects of cannabinoid vapor administration with those of other routes of administration. This review will serve as a guide for past and current vapor delivery methods in animals, synergize findings across studies, and propose future directions for this area of research.

Prisons are susceptible to outbreaks. Control measures focusing on isolation and cohorting negatively affect wellbeing. We present an outbreak of coronavirus disease 2019 (COVID-19) in a large male prison in Wales, UK, October 2020 to April 2021, and discuss control measures.We gathered case-information, including demographics, staff-residence postcode, resident cell number, work areas/dates, test results, staff interview dates/notes and resident prison-transfer dates. Epidemiological curves were mapped by prison location. Control measures included isolation (exclusion from work or cell-isolation), cohorting (new admissions and work-area groups), asymptomatic testing (case-finding), removal of communal dining and movement restrictions. Facemask use and enhanced hygiene were already in place. Whole-genome sequencing (WGS) and interviews determined the genetic relationship between cases plausibility of transmission.Of 453 cases, 53% (n = 242) were staff, most aged 25-34 years (11.5% females, 27.15% males) and symptomatic (64%). Crude attack-rate was higher in staff (29%, 95% CI 26-64%) than in residents (12%, 95% CI 9-15%).Whole-genome sequencing can help differentiate multiple introductions from person-to-person transmission in prisons. It should be introduced alongside asymptomatic testing as soon as possible to control prison outbreaks. Timely epidemiological investigation, including data visualisation, allowed dynamic risk assessment and proportionate control measures, minimising the reduction in resident welfare.

BACKGROUND: A subset of patients without overt systemic lupus erythematosus (SLE) present with biopsy findings typically seen in lupus nephritis (LN). Although a minority eventually develops SLE, many do not. It remains unclear how to classify or treat these patients. Our study attempted to further understand the clinical and pathological characteristics of cases with lupus-like nephritis (LLN). METHODS: Among 2700 native kidney biopsies interpreted at University of Rochester Medical Center (URMC) from 2010 to 2019, we identified 27 patients with biopsies showing lupus-like features (LL-fx) and 96 with LN. Of those with LL-fx, 17 were idiopathic LLN and 10 were associated with a secondary etiology (e.g., infection/drugs). RESULTS: At the time of biopsy, the LLN-group tended to be slightly older (44 vs. 35), male (58.8 vs. 17.7%, p = .041), and Caucasian (47.0 vs. 28.1%, p = .005). Chronic kidney disease was the most common biopsy indication in LLN (21.4 vs. 2.8%, p = .001). Both LN and LLN presented with nephrotic-range proteinuria (mean 5.73 vs. 4.40 g/d), and elevated serum creatinine (mean 1.66 vs. 1.47 mg/dL). Tubuloreticular inclusions (TRIs; p < .001) and fibrous crescents (p = .04) were more often seen in LN, while more tubulointerstitial scarring was seen in LLN (p = .011). At mean follow-up of 1684 d (range: 31-4323), none of the LLN patients developed ESRD. A subset of both LN and cases with LL-fx overlapped with other autoimmune diseases. CONCLUSIONS: Lupus-like pathologic features are seen in a wide array of disease processes. The findings suggest that LLN may be a manifestation of an autoimmune process that overlaps with SLE.

We investigated the dynamics of seroconversion in severe acute respiratory syndrome coronavirus 2 (SARS-CoV-2) infection. During March 29-May 22, 2020, we collected serum samples and associated clinical data from 177 persons in London, UK, who had SARS-CoV-2 infection. We measured IgG against SARS-CoV-2 and compared antibody levels with patient outcomes, demographic information, and laboratory characteristics. We found that 2.0%-8.5% of persons did not seroconvert 3-6 weeks after infection. Persons who seroconverted were older, were more likely to have concurrent conditions, and had higher levels of inflammatory markers. Non-White persons had higher antibody concentrations than those who identified as White; these concentrations did not decline during follow-up. Serologic assay results correlated with disease outcome, race, and other risk factors for severe SARS-CoV-2 infection. Serologic assays can be used in surveillance to clarify the duration and protective nature of humoral responses to SARS-CoV-2 infection.

BACKGROUND: HIV remains one of the most important health issues worldwide, with almost 40 million people living with HIV. Although patients develop antibodies against the virus, its high mutation rate allows evasion of immune responses. Some patients, however, produce antibodies that are able to bind to, and neutralise different strains of HIV. One such 'broadly neutralising' antibody is 'N6'. Identified in 2016, N6 can neutralise 98% of HIV-1 isolates with a median IC50 of 0.066 µg/mL. This neutralisation breadth makes N6 a very promising therapeutic candidate. RESULTS: N6 was expressed in a glycoengineered line of N. benthamiana plants (pN6) and compared to the mammalian cell-expressed equivalent (mN6). Expression at 49 mg/kg (fresh leaf tissue) was achieved in plants, although extraction and purification are more challenging than for most plant-expressed antibodies. N-glycoanalysis demonstrated the absence of xylosylation and a reduction in α(1,3)-fucosylation that are typically found in plant glycoproteins. The N6 light chain contains a potential N-glycosylation site, which was modified and displayed more α(1,3)-fucose than the heavy chain. The binding kinetics of pN6 and mN6, measured by surface plasmon resonance, were similar for HIV gp120. pN6 had a tenfold higher affinity for FcγRIIIa, which was reflected in an antibody-dependent cellular cytotoxicity assay, where pN6 induced a more potent response from effector cells than that of mN6. pN6 demonstrated the same potency and breadth of neutralisation as mN6, against a panel of HIV strains. CONCLUSIONS: The successful expression of N6 in tobacco supports the prospect of developing a low-cost, low-tech production platform for a monoclonal antibody cocktail to control HIV in low-to middle income countries.

MOTIVATION: Influenza viruses represent a global public health burden due to annual epidemics and pandemic potential. Due to a rapidly evolving RNA genome, inter-species transmission, intra-host variation, and noise in short-read data, reads can be lost during mapping, and de novo assembly can be time consuming and result in misassembly. We assessed read loss during mapping and designed a graph-based classifier, VAPOR, for selecting mapping references, assembly validation and detection of strains of non-human origin. RESULTS: Standard human reference viruses were insufficient for mapping diverse influenza samples in simulation. VAPOR retrieved references for 257 real whole-genome sequencing samples with a mean of >99.8% identity to assemblies, and increased the proportion of mapped reads by up to 13.3% compared to standard references. VAPOR has the potential to improve the robustness of bioinformatics pipelines for surveillance and could be adapted to other RNA viruses. Across the United States, nursing practice acts (NPAs) have been revised to include provisions that promote full practice authority (FPA) for nurse practitioners (NPs). Such revisions provide a mechanism to better utilize the full scope of NP services to address growing demands for access to health care. Modernized NPAs that facilitate FPA for NPs are imperative, especially now with the unprecedented health care crisis that the world now faces: Coronavirus Disease 2019. This is the first known study to use an embedded single-case study design, guided by the Kingdon policy stream model, to provide a detailed account of how stakeholders for NP FPA determine the appropriate time to pursue legislative changes to NP scope of practice regulations. Qualitative data analysis revealed four themes which comprised the components considered by stakeholders during their decision-making processes related to NP FPA: participants, problem, policy development, and politics. Themes were further collapsed within concepts from the Kingdon model to form the case description. Study findings can be used to increase the competency among NP FPA stakeholders in determining the timing of legislative pursuits for regulatory change.

The prevalence of obesity is growing, and breast reconstruction in the obese patient is becoming the norm rather than the exception. Our aim was to evaluate implant reconstruction outcomes in the obese female in the presence of coincident surgical risk factors and identify potential risk-reducing interventions. A review of consecutive obese women (BMI ≥ 30) who underwent mastectomy and implant breast reconstruction was performed. Patient demographics, comorbidities, oncologic treatments, and reconstructive procedures and their complications were recorded. A total of 151 women (242 breast reconstructions) were included with mean follow-up of 28 months. Average BMI was 36. Eighty percent of cases were immediate and 20% delayed. ADMs were utilized in 58% of cases. About 25% of patients had diabetes with one-third achieving perioperative glycemic control. About 18% of women were active smokers, and 33% had radiotherapy. Major and minor complications occurred in 42% and 11% of patients, respectively. About 24% of reconstructed breasts required implant removal. Obese patients with prior radiation were three times as likely to develop infection (P = 0.008) and 2.5× as likely to undergo explantation (P = 0.002). Skin flap necrosis was three times as likely in obese smokers (P = 0.01). Increased rates of wound breakdown were identified in obese patients with increasing age (P = 0.005), smoking (P = 0.0035), and radiation (P = 0.023). In the obese radiated and smoking patient subgroups, surgical modifications (use of autologous tissue, delayed breast reconstruction timing, and no ADM) were associated with reduction in the relative risk for implant complications. While obesity alone increases implant breast reconstruction complication rates, the presence of additional risk factors compounds these rates. The use of surgical modifications may reduce the occurrence of perioperative complications in the obese female with coincident surgical risk factors undergoing implant breast reconstruction.

BackgroundIn the United Kingdom (UK), in recent influenza seasons, children are offered a quadrivalent live attenuated influenza vaccine (LAIV4), and eligible adults mainly trivalent inactivated vaccine (TIV).AimTo estimate the UK end-of-season 2017/18 adjusted vaccine effectiveness (aVE) and the seroprevalence in England of antibodies against influenza viruses cultured in eggs or tissue.MethodsThis observational study employed the test-negative case-control approach to estimate aVE in primary care. The population-based seroprevalence survey used residual age-stratified samples.ResultsInfluenza viruses A(H3N2) (particularly subgroup 3C.2a2) and B (mainly B/Yamagata/16/88-lineage, similar to the quadrivalent vaccine B-virus component but mismatched to TIV) dominated. All-age aVE was 15% (95% confidence interval (CI): -6.3 to 32) against all influenza; -16.4% (95% CI: -59.3 to 14.9) against A(H3N2); 24.7% (95% CI: 1.1 to 42.7) against B and 66.3% (95% CI: 33.4 to 82.9) against A(H1N1)pdm09. For 2-17 year olds, LAIV4 aVE was 26.9% (95% CI: -32.6 to 59.7) against all influenza; -75.5% (95% CI: -289.6 to 21) against A(H3N2); 60.8% (95% CI: 8.2 to 83.3) against B and 90.3% (95% CI: 16.4 to 98.9) against A(H1N1)pdm09. For ≥ 18 year olds, TIV aVE against influenza B was 1.9% (95% CI: -63.6 to 41.2). The 2017 seroprevalence of antibody recognising tissue-grown A(H3N2) virus was significantly lower than that recognising egg-grown virus in all groups except 15-24 year olds.ConclusionsOverall aVE was low driven by no effectiveness against A(H3N2) possibly related to vaccine virus egg-adaption and a new A(H3N2) subgroup emergence. The TIV was not effective against influenza B. LAIV4 against influenza B and A(H1N1)pdm09 was effective.

Diffuse nitrate leaching from agricultural areas is a major environmental problem in many parts of the world. Understanding where in a catchment nitrate is removed is key for designing effective land use management strategies that protect water quality, while minimizing the impact on economic development. In this study we assess the effects of spatially targeted nitrate leaching regulation in a basin with limited knowledge of the complexity of chemical heterogeneity. Three alternative nitrate reactivity spatial parameterizations were incorporated in a catchment-scale flow and transport model and used to evaluate the effectiveness of four possible spatially targeted regulation options. Our findings confirm that denitrification parameterization cannot be numerically determined based on model inversion alone. Detailed field based characterization using physical and geochemical methods should be considered and incorporated in the numerical inversion scheme. We also demonstrate that there are potential benefits of implementing spatially targeted regulation compared to spatially uniform regulation. Focusing regulation in areas where nitrate residence time is short, such as riparian zones or areas with low natural N-reduction, results in greater reduction of N-discharges through groundwater. Significantly improved efficiencies can be expected when delineation of management zones considers the chemical heterogeneity and groundwater flow paths. These improved efficiencies are achieved by adopting management rules that regulate land use in discharge sensitive areas, where leaching changes contribute the most to the catchment nitrate discharges. In our case study, regulation in discharge sensitive zones was twice as efficient compared to other management options.

Leucine-rich repeat-containing G protein-coupled receptor 5 (LGR5) is a bona fide marker of adult stem cells in several epithelial tissues, most notably in the intestinal crypts, and is highly up-regulated in many colorectal, hepatocellular, and ovarian cancers. LGR5 activation by R-spondin (RSPO) ligands potentiates Wnt/ß-catenin signaling in vitro; however, deletion of LGR5 in stem cells has little or no effect on Wnt/ß-catenin signaling or cell proliferation in vivo Remarkably, modulation of LGR5 expression has a major impact on the actin cytoskeletal structure and cell adhesion in the absence of RSPO stimulation, but the molecular mechanism is unclear. Here, we show that LGR5 interacts with IQ motif-containing GTPase-activating protein 1 (IQGAP1), an effector of Rac1/CDC42 GTPases, in the regulation of actin cytoskeleton dynamics and cell-cell adhesion. Specifically, LGR5 decreased levels of IQGAP1 phosphorylation at Ser-1441/1443, leading to increased binding of Rac1 to IQGAP1 and thus higher levels of cortical F-actin and enhanced cell-cell adhesion. LGR5 ablation in colon cancer cells and crypt stem cells resulted in loss of cortical F-actin, reduced cell-cell adhesion, and disrupted localization of adhesion-associated proteins. No evidence of LGR5 coupling to any of the four major subtypes of heterotrimeric G proteins was found. These findings suggest that LGR5 primarily functions via the IQGAP1-Rac1 pathway to strengthen cell-cell adhesion in normal adult crypt stem cells and colon cancer cells.

Binge eating disorder is an addiction-like disorder characterized by recurrent, excessive food consumption within discrete periods of time, and it has been linked to increased trait impulsivity. Within impulsivity components, while impulsive action was shown to predict binge-like and addictive-like eating, the role of impulsive choice is instead unknown. The goal of this study was to determine if impulsive choice predicted, or was altered by binge-like eating of a sugary, highly palatable diet. We utilized a modified adjusting delay task procedure in free-fed rats to assess impulsive choice behavior, that is. the tendency to respond for a larger, delayed reward over a lesser, immediate reward. We found that baseline impulsive choice was not a predictor of binge-like eating in 1-h sessions of palatable diet operant self-administration. Furthermore, binge-like eating of the same palatable diet had no effect on later impulsive choice behavior. Thus, our data suggest that, unlike impulsive action, impulsive choice behavior does not predict binge-like eating in rats.

Since 7 June 2018, an enterovirus D-68 (EV-D68) season (the third since 2015) is ongoing in Wales, with 114 confirmed cases thus far. Median age of the 220 cases since 2015 is 2.5 years (2.5 years in intensive care cases), 94% were hospitalised, 17% (n = 38) in intensive care. All had respiratory symptoms; bronchiolitis symptoms were reported in 60 cases, severe respiratory symptoms in 23 and acute flaccid myelitis in two cases.

BackgroundIn 2016/17, seasonal influenza vaccine was less effective in those aged 65 years and older in the United Kingdom. We describe the uptake, influenza-associated mortality and adjusted vaccine effectiveness (aVE) in this age group over influenza seasons 2010/11-2016/17. Methods: Vaccine uptake in 2016/17 and five previous seasons were measured using a sentinel general practitioners cohort in England; the test-negative case-control design was used to estimate pooled aVE by subtype and age group against laboratory-confirmed influenza in primary care from 2010-2017. Results: Vaccine uptake was 64% in 65-69-year-olds, 74% in 70-74-year-olds and 80% in those aged 75 and older. Overall aVE was 32.5% (95% CI: 11.6 to 48.5); aVE by sub-type was 60.8% (95% CI: 33.9 to 76.7) and 50.0% (95% CI: 21.6 to 68.1) against influenza A(H1N1)pdm09 and influenza B, respectively, but only 5.6% (95% CI: - 39.2 to 35.9) against A(H3N2). Against all laboratory-confirmed influenza aVE was 45.2% (95% CI: 25.1 to 60.0) in 65-74 year olds; - 26.2% (95% CI: - 149.3 to 36.0) in 75-84 year olds and - 3.2% (95% CI: - 237.8 to 68.5) in those aged 85 years and older. Influenza-attributable mortality was highest in seasons dominated by A(H3N2). Conclusions: Vaccine uptake with non-adjuvanted, normal-dose vaccines remained high, with evidence of effectiveness against influenza A(H1N1)pdm09 and B, though poor against A(H3N2), particularly in those aged 75 years and older. Forthcoming availability of newly licensed vaccines with wider use of antivirals can potentially further improve prevention and control of influenza in this group.
